About agriculture in Lanzac

Lanzac is situated in the Lot department within the Occitanie region of southwestern France. The surrounding landscape is characteristic of the Quercy region, defined by rolling limestone plateaus, deep river valleys, and a mix of deciduous woodlands and open pastoral fields.

Agriculture in this area is diverse, reflecting the unique geography of the Lot valley. Traditional farming focuses on cereal production, orchards—particularly walnut groves—and livestock rearing, including sheep and cattle. Small-scale diversified farms are common, often integrating local traditions with modern sustainable practices.
